Triple D chefs entertain troops

This post is more Diners, Drive-ins and Dives related than Guy Fieri related. But I thought that this would be an appropriate 9/11 post, and fans of Triple D might like to know ....

According to the San Jose Murcury News, this October the Navy has invited America's Chefs to bring six chefs to the U.S. military stations. Four of the chefs are straight from Diners, Drive-ins and Dives.

The purpose of the visits is to provide entertainment, education and boost morale through culinary related shows and demonstrations for the U.S. military and their families.

Representing Diners, Drive-Ins and Dives are chefs Rich Bacchi of Gorilla Barbeque (Smokin' BBQ), Hodad of Hodad's (Seaside Eats), Panini Pete of Panini Pete's (Real Deal Fast Food), and Stretch of Grinders & Grinders West (Off the Hook Specials).


CJ Jacobson of The Yard, Santa Monica and Ryan Scott, private chef, San Francisco from Bravo's Top Chef are included.

In early August 2010, America's Chefs tested the show at Fleet Week, during the annual Seattle Seafair, with rave reviews from the crowd.
